作用域

如何在復雜的代碼結(jié)構(gòu)中理清變量的作用域?-小浪學習網(wǎng)

如何在復雜的代碼結(jié)構(gòu)中理清變量的作用域?

變量作用域的定義與作用:變量作用域指的是變量在程序中的可見范圍和生命周期。理解變量作用域的關(guān)鍵在于知道在哪里可以訪問和修改這些變量,以及它們在程序執(zhí)行過程中何時被創(chuàng)建和銷毀。工作原...
站長的頭像-小浪學習網(wǎng)站長21天前
4311
python服務器運行代碼報錯怎么解決-小浪學習網(wǎng)

python服務器運行代碼報錯怎么解決

本文將為您提供詳細的指南,介紹如何解決python服務器運行代碼時遇到的常見報錯問題。希望通過閱讀這篇文章,您能找到有效的解決方案。 Python服務器運行代碼報錯的解決方法 在運行Python服務器...
站長的頭像-小浪學習網(wǎng)站長22天前
3915
Linux系統(tǒng)編程:進程地址空間-小浪學習網(wǎng)

Linux系統(tǒng)編程:進程地址空間

一,內(nèi)存地址空間1.1,棧區(qū)存儲變量:普通局部變量、指針變量、函數(shù)參數(shù)、函數(shù)返回地址、臨時變量、寄存器變量; 函數(shù)參數(shù):函數(shù)的參數(shù)是從右到左依次入棧的; 在vs2022上棧區(qū)并不是'向下生長的',而是...
c++類的構(gòu)造函數(shù)和析構(gòu)函數(shù)的作用-小浪學習網(wǎng)

c++類的構(gòu)造函數(shù)和析構(gòu)函數(shù)的作用

構(gòu)造函數(shù)和析構(gòu)函數(shù)在c++++中分別負責對象的初始化和資源釋放。1.構(gòu)造函數(shù)在對象創(chuàng)建時自動調(diào)用,初始化成員變量。2.析構(gòu)函數(shù)在對象生命周期結(jié)束時自動調(diào)用,釋放資源。兩者確保了資源的正確管...
站長的頭像-小浪學習網(wǎng)站長23天前
237
如何使用lambda表達式?-小浪學習網(wǎng)

如何使用lambda表達式?

lambda表達式是一種簡潔的匿名函數(shù),適用于需要短小精悍的函數(shù)定義場景。1) 它簡化代碼,使其更簡潔易讀;2) 支持函數(shù)式編程,實現(xiàn)高階函數(shù)和閉包;3) 提供靈活性,適合一次性或短期使用的函數(shù)...
站長的頭像-小浪學習網(wǎng)站長23天前
495
Linux__之__基于UDP的Socket編程網(wǎng)絡(luò)通信-小浪學習網(wǎng)

Linux__之__基于UDP的Socket編程網(wǎng)絡(luò)通信

前言 本文旨在通過Linux系統(tǒng)接口實現(xiàn)網(wǎng)絡(luò)通信,幫助我們更好地掌握socket套接字的使用。通過學習socket網(wǎng)絡(luò)通信,我們將發(fā)現(xiàn)網(wǎng)絡(luò)通信的本質(zhì)不過是套路。接下來,讓我們直接進入代碼編寫部分。 ...
如何在函數(shù)內(nèi)部正確訪問外部作用域的變量?-小浪學習網(wǎng)

如何在函數(shù)內(nèi)部正確訪問外部作用域的變量?

在函數(shù)內(nèi)部訪問外部作用域的變量可以通過閉包和作用域鏈實現(xiàn)。1.在javascript中,內(nèi)部函數(shù)可以直接訪問外部函數(shù)的變量。2.在python中,需要使用global關(guān)鍵字來聲明和修改全局變量。合理使用這些...
站長的頭像-小浪學習網(wǎng)站長23天前
4410
如何在 Edge 瀏覽器中調(diào)試 js 代碼-小浪學習網(wǎng)

如何在 Edge 瀏覽器中調(diào)試 js 代碼

在 edge 瀏覽器中調(diào)試 javascript 代碼可以通過以下步驟實現(xiàn):1. 啟動開發(fā)者工具,按 f12 或右鍵點擊頁面選擇“檢查元素”。2. 設(shè)置斷點,在代碼行號處點擊設(shè)置斷點,代碼執(zhí)行到此處會暫停。3. ...
站長的頭像-小浪學習網(wǎng)站長23天前
465
當多個閉包引用同一個外部變量時,可能會出現(xiàn)什么問題?-小浪學習網(wǎng)

當多個閉包引用同一個外部變量時,可能會出現(xiàn)什么問題?

當多個閉包引用同一個外部變量時,會導致變量共享問題,影響程序行為。解決方案包括:1. 使用立即調(diào)用的函數(shù)表達式(iife)創(chuàng)建獨立變量;2. 使用對象封裝變量和函數(shù),確保每個閉包獨立。 引言 ...
站長的頭像-小浪學習網(wǎng)站長23天前
256
簡述Java中變量的作用域規(guī)則。-小浪學習網(wǎng)

簡述Java中變量的作用域規(guī)則。

java中變量的作用域分為局部變量和成員變量。1.局部變量在方法或代碼塊內(nèi)有效,從聲明點到代碼塊結(jié)束。2.成員變量包括實例變量和靜態(tài)變量,實例變量在對象生命周期內(nèi)有效,靜態(tài)變量在程序運行期...
站長的頭像-小浪學習網(wǎng)站長24天前
405
Python中的變量是如何定義和使用的?-小浪學習網(wǎng)

Python中的變量是如何定義和使用的?

在python中,變量的定義和使用非常直觀:1. 定義變量時無需聲明類型,python會自動推斷類型;2. 使用變量時直接引用變量名;3. 變量有全局和局部作用域,需注意使用;4. 變量名是對象的引用,需...
站長的頭像-小浪學習網(wǎng)站長24天前
3812